Welcome to the vibrant University District in Seattle, Washington, a neighborhood known for its youthful energy and academic atmosphere. Situated in King County, this bustling area is home to the prestigious University of Washington, making it a hub for students, faculty, and professionals alike.
The University District is a diverse and dynamic community offering a mix of residential streets, bustling commercial areas, and serene green spaces. Residents enjoy easy access to a wide range of amenities, including trendy cafes, eclectic shops, and cultural attractions. With its proximity to downtown Seattle, the neighborhood offers the perfect blend of urban convenience and laid-back charm.
